This month I have taken a card from the Xultan Tarot deck – a deck based on the Maya culture and artwork. It is an in depth deck though and has a very good Jungian companion book for the majors called The Mayan Book of Life by David Owen.

This months card is 5 cups. The card itself is brightly coloured as the whole deck is. The top part of the card is green and the bottom turquoise. I see two images of sadness immediately the character at the top is walking forward looking downwards arms crossed and sad down turned mouth. I see he covers his heart chakra with his arms and his eyes are closed.

The other image on the card I am drawn to is below the man’s feet and shows a face with someone with their eyes closed and a tear dropping from their eye. I see a hand there too and have the phrase ‘gripped with emotion’ come to me. As we move further down the card there are 5 cups – 3 have been upturned and spilt their contents on the floor the other 2 are neatly upright and still full.
